The next thing is for an individual to know if their bones will be harvested or if an allograft is a perfect choice. However, most people prefer having patients use those from donors. This is because some people suffer from long-time pain in the areas where the bone was harvested. Certain activities have to be conducted by the doctor, such as sterilization. The surgeon will be the right person to recommend the right allograft bone for use by the patient.

It is imperative to know what complications are associated with the surgery. In most instances, it will vary from one patient to another, depending on the operation. For example, some people suffer from infections, and thus, proper measures will be taken to prevent infections. Hence they will have to take antibiotics.
